Output 4e5b497656dd42b83beaeb4af1bed7789bbee7a1e2b065faa90a7b66e4d00a79:1

value
20684496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37634b9f210d65486ed7bbdf9a679cfeeba4f OP_EQUAL
address
3BMEXhofLkqYjbCo4Vp3LRfFXBgGXjJzm3
transaction
4e5b497656dd42b83beaeb4af1bed7789bbee7a1e2b065faa90a7b66e4d00a79
confirmations
381915
spent
true